The Maryland Rural Development Corporation (MRDC) is a private non-profit organization that provides services in response to the needs of rural, low-income households and communities. MRDC serves as Caroline, Cecil, and Kent Counties’ official Community Action Agency.
The Head Start Teacher develops and implements individual education plans for children, which help them to develop socially, intellectually, physically, and emotionally in a manner appropriate to their stage of development. The teacher works collaboratively with the Site Supervisor and MRDC team.
Typical Duties:
+ Implement developmentally appropriate curriculum for preschool children per guidance from the Education Coordinator, the ECE Specialist, and other leaders, individualizing instruction as necessary
+ Perform the functions with a understanding of the Head Start Performance Standards
+ Refer children suspected of having special needs or challenging behavior to appropriate staff
+ Implement behavior plans and IEPs designed with the team, families, schools, and mental health professionals, putting an emphasis on creating the least restrictive environment possible
+ Guide and facilitate activities of the children, including: daily activities, field trips, selecting and arranging equipment and materials in the classroom
+ Cooperate with other staff and classroom groups to maintain the smooth functioning of the center, which at times may require changes to meet the needs of the children
+ Maintain a comprehensive and ongoing portfolio assessment for each child, including weekly observations in each area, examples of the child's work, and a developmental assessment, completed as per designated procedure
+ Foster a positive learning atmosphere that encourages creativity, curiosity, and exploration
+ Maintain a clean, safe, and organized classroom environment
+ Supervise children at all times and implement positive behavior management strategies
+ Attend training sessions, workshops, and staff meetings to enhance professional skills
+ Assure that files are complete, accurate, and confidentially maintained
